February is a sweet time for Nanaimo residents and tourists as the Maple Sugar Festival du Sucre d'Érable launches into high gear to celebrate the cultures and traditions of diverse parts of Canada. Presented by the Francophone Association of Nanaimo (the AFN), this unique event kicks off on with two days of high-quality school shows for young audiences and teens. As well, students sample mouth-watering maple toffee on snow created right before their very eyes. On the weekend, the Centennial Building at Beban Park buzzes with lots of family activities. French Canadian festivities offered over the weekend include educational exhibits, music, clowns, authentic foods, and a genuine atmosphere of joie de vivre. Enjoy a variety of maple sugar products, treat yourself to a hardy lumberjack breakfast or the traditional home-made tourtière meat pie and poutine. Stroll through various exhibition tents and learn the ancient art of tree tapping; be awed by world-famous ice carvers' artistic sculptures. Or simply sit back and relax to the sounds of folk and contemporary music from some of Canada’s best performers. Renown performers are also featured on Wednesday (Port Theatre) and Saturday nights.
